Why Choose a Mesothelioma Law Firm?

A mesothelioma lawyer can help victims receive compensation for medical expenses, lost wages and other expenses. They also aid with asbestos trust funds.

They will examine your medical records and job history to determine whether you are eligible for a mesothelioma case. They will investigate the exposure and identify possible responsible parties.

National Firms

National mesothelioma companies can represent asbestos victims across more than one state, as opposed to local asbestos law firms. This versatility is beneficial for asbestos sufferers, since their exposure could have occurred in many different places. The lawyers at these firms are able to file claims in all applicable jurisdictions, and can assist victims in seeking the highest amount of compensation possible.

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ma can examine medical records of patients to determine their asbestos exposure. They can then help to seek compensation from responsible parties. These firms have access various resources that can help strengthen the case. This includes documents from the company as well as expert witness testimony and mesothelioma studies. Attorneys can also provide a thorough legal analysis and explain the process of compensation.

Many mesothelioma lawyers who are experienced have experience representing clients in lawsuits and asbestos trust fund claims. This ensures that the compensation is adequate to cover the expenses of treatment and other expenses related to mesothelioma. Attorneys can help veterans determine if additional compensation is available from trusts funded by the government, which were set up to assist veterans who were exposed to asbestos during their service in the military.

Contingency Fees

When a person is diagnosed with mesothelioma, or has lost a loved one to this cancer caused by asbestos, it's vital to find a law firm that can help secure compensation. This compensation can be used to assist patients and family members cover medical costs as well as pay for lost income and other financial hardships that are associated with the mesothelioma.

Mesothelioma lawyers in top law firms are dedicated to helping victims get the compensation they are entitled to. They have a proven track of obtaining multimillion-dollar settlements and verdicts for asbestos victims. They are familiar with every state's legal system with regards to mesothelioma cases.

The mesothelioma attorneys at the top firms also work on a contingency fee basis which means that the victim or their family do not have to pay any upfront costs. Attorneys are only paid when the case is won and the victim receives compensation. In most cases the client is responsible for additional costs such as photocopying or court filing fees.

Mesothelioma patients should make sure to work with a law firm that has a branch in their state of residence or at the very least close. This will allow them to come to the firm to discuss their case and the details of how their lawyer will handle the case. Mesothelioma lawyers will travel for victims and family members to meet them.

Law firms like the nationally recognized mesothelioma attorneys from Weitz & Luxenberg and Simmons Hanly Conroy have offices across the country so they can easily meet with victims at locations closer to their.

A reputable mesothelioma litigation lawyer will take the details of a case of a victim and decide how to assist them in pursuing justice against negligent asbestos producers. They will also explain how the law impacts their clients' particular circumstances. They will also go through all evidence, including medical records of the victims. Moreover, a good mesothelioma lawyer will be aware of the potential deadlines and limitations that come with filing claims. This is important as there are strict deadlines for victims to file lawsuits against mesothelioma.
